#C28EF1 Hex Color Code

#C28EF1

The Hexadecimal Color #C28EF1 is a contrast shade of Plum. #C28EF1 RGB value is rgb(194, 142, 241). RGB Color Model of #C28EF1 consists of 76% red, 55% green and 94% blue. HSL color Mode of #C28EF1 has 272°(degrees) Hue, 78% Saturation and 75% Lightness. #C28EF1 color has an wavelength of 448.74074n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#C28EF1 is #CC99F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#C28EF1 is #B8E. The Closest Color to #C28EF1 is #DDA0DD. Official Name of #C28EF1 Hex Code is Light Wisteria.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#C28EF1 is 20 Cyan 41 Magenta 0 Yellow 5 Black and #C28EF1 CMY is 20, 41,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#C28EF1 is hsl(272,78,75,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(272, 41, 95).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#C28EF1 is 47.8, 37.17, 87.86.
Hex8 Value of #C28EF1 is #C28EF1FF. Decimal Value of #C28EF1 is 12750577 and Octal Value of #C28EF1 is 60507361. Binary Value of #C28EF1 is 11000010, 10001110, 11110001 and Android of #C28EF1 is 4290940657 / 0xffc28ef1.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#C28EF1 is 0.277, 0.215, 0.215 and YIQ Color Space of #C28EF1 is 168.834, -0.8219, 41.8068.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#C28EF1 is 36.73, 30.0, 87.05.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#C28EF1 is 67.4, 38.12, -42.4.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#C28EF1 is 67.4, 19.45, -73.05.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#C28EF1 is 67.4, 57.02, 311.96. Hunter Lab variable of #C28EF1 is 60.97, 33.26, -42.77.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#C28EF1

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
